Currently GitLens falls back to terminal execution for certain git commands. It was mainly done out of convenience to avoid needing to handle many error cases, but also so that the user could easily tweak the command and execute it again themselves.

We should replace those terminal-run command with custom command like all our other Git commands, though it could still be really nice to offer to open the terminal with the command as an option/button on an error dialog/notification if the user chooses.

Can find all the commands that call this:

async runGitCommandViaTerminal(cwd: string, command: string, args: string[], options?: { execute?: boolean }) {

Which really boils down to callers of:

private async runTerminalCommand(command: string, ...args: string[]) {
await this.container.git.runGitCommandViaTerminal?.(this.uri, command, args, { execute: true });
setTimeout(() => this.fireChange(RepositoryChange.Unknown), 2500);
}
